Actress Beverly Naya Says Being Called A “Queen” Too Early Is A Red Flag

Being called a Queen is a red flag?Reading it makes sense!

 Actress Beverly Naya says she’s never been comfortable with men calling her “Queen,” especially early on in the relationship, because it feels less like admiration and more like projection. 


She explained that when a man uses that title before knowing her boundaries, character, or values, he isn’t seeing her, he’s responding to an idea he’s created. 
She says “When a man meets you, he doesn’t actually know you yet, so when he puts you on a pedestal, he’s not responding to you as a person, he’s responding to a fantasy.” 

She says that pedestal creates pressure to perform and stay impressive, even unconsciously, just to maintain an image she never asked for. 
She believes this kind of early idealization is a form of love‑bombing because it creates emotional distance and prevents genuine connection. 

In her view, real interest is patient, real respect is curious, and the safest love doesn’t rush to label you but meets you where you are and chooses the real person, not the imagined version.
